Home Sweet Home Starts With State Farm
Being at home is great, but being at home with protection from State Farm is the cherry on top. This fantastic coverage is more than just precautionary in case of damage from fire or ice storm. It also can cover you in certain legal cases, such as someone having an accident in your home and holding you responsible. If you have the right coverage, your insurance may cover these costs.
